The only staple insects are roaches, silks and crix. Pheonix worms are very high in calcium but I don’t think enough research has been done on them to deem them a good staple. I do think pheonix, horn, super (not mealworms, very high in fat and a hard exoskeleton that’s difficult to digest), wax and butter worms are ok for an occassional treat.

no meal worms, they have a hard shell that the beardies can not digest, and can cause impaction!! as for the roaches, i haven’t tried them myself, but i have heard that you keep them in a tall rubbermaid container and have a heat lamp on them, but again, this is just what i have heard. i personally use a combination of crix, greens and veggies, occasional carrots and fruit, silk worms, butter worms and phoenix worms. make sure you get the proper supplements too, cause calcium is extremely important to beardies and reptiles.

Hey Cappy.. I have lobster roaches and I’m about to get more. Anyways.. order those. They are great. They do crawl up surfaces but they dont fly! :) If you get a large tupperware like up to your knees..a 100 gallon I think and put your roaches in there... put a 3" line of vaseline on the top of the sides so when and if they crawl up the sides they will get detured. They usuually dont get stuck,so dont worry. After a day or two they become chill and hang out on the bottom. You need egg crates..that is their "beds" and they will mate. If you put a heat pad under them or a light that has the heat up to 92 or so they will mate. Then you wont have to order many more. But remember, when you get them, they come in all sizes so only feed your beardie (when you get it) the size between his eyes and keep the other ones for mating.
